"Although I consider myself to be a fan of most all kinds of music, through the years I had heard of but always dismissed this thing called “House” or “Techno” music. I had always considered it to be cold, unemotional and dare I say, an unskillful. DJ Shar4 has vowed to change all that for me.
The night was cold, snowless, in White River Junction, Vermont. It seemed to me an uncommon place to hear pounding bass leaking from an older brick building, the frosted doors constantly changing color. Stranger still, the Tupelo Music Hall is more known to host acts like the Mickey Hart Band, New Riders of the Purple Sage and Dr. Burma. Tonight, however, is for DJ Shar4.
DJs like Shara help prove that House DJs put the same amount of emotion and feeling into their music as traditional bands. She composes her own beats and for this show mixed in some live keyboard playing.
DJ Shar4 has been an Upper Valley staple with the House crowd and dance club followers. In just a few years she has amassed a following among young and old alike. Recently she has been playing at the Salt Hill Pub in Hanover, NH, a stones throw from Dartmouth College.
“I have recently reached several international students who found out about me when they stumbled across my event in their town. It makes perfect sense that they love it because House music is huge in Europe and South America! For example, one student is from Greece and another from London; they are now huge fans who help spread the word.”

Shar4 is also very involved in the community for which she generally plays. When asked about how her current philanthropist gigs got their start: “My first charity dance party was in August of 2007; the idea of bringing people together to dance while helping humanity was with me at the very beginning of my DJ career. To this day I'm not completely sure where that idea came from, but it stuck! As I continued to throw these types of parties and they kept growing; I decided the party needed to have a name so I searched "Charity" in a Thesaurus and "Devotion" came up. Hence, "DeVote" was born.”
DJ Shar4 estimates about half of her performances fall under the name “DeVote” where attendees are asked to bring toys, children's books, canned goods or whatever the theme of the night happens to be.
She shares that her favorite show was a weekend long house party in “The Middle of Nowhere, Alaska.” The host had converted the basement into a bar and light show. But for her, a perfect show is one where she raises sufficient money and donations.
Her Montreal visits helped foster her love of the sound and the scene. Not long after, she had her own turntables and was playing to her own crowds. Montreal - Boston - Providence - Alaska - NYC - and now, White River Junction. We sometimes take for granted the musical talent that can found locally. Shar4 is proof of a good time, and proof passion comes in all forms."

1
& 2.) My name is Shara with the alias of ShaR4. 4 having been taken
from my favorite phrase "Dance 4 Me." I grew to love the idea of making
people dance 4 me 4 years ago. 4 is also my lucky number and seems to
be popular in my life one way or another, so it only seemed natural to
take it with me on my DJ journey.
3.) My musical background
has helped a lot with my DJ journey, especially on the music production
side of things. Having a good foundation of rhythm is obviously key for
beat matching and I have my parents to thank for surrounding me with
music ever since they put me on this planet. My mother also blessed me
with dance lessons for many years, so I think I have decent rhythm for
the most part! :)
4.) I love seeing that more females are
making themselves known in the DJ world. I feel very comfortable even
though I am a small number compared to the males in this profession. But
I like being different than the majority so it works out so far!
5.) I'd say the biggest misconceptions of being a DJ is that it's an
easy job. After getting enough experience, then yes it can become easy
in some ways, but it is still a very stressful job at times. Sometimes
the sound is not good in the room which can throw your mixing
capabilities off and you don't know this until you're about to go on.
Also, you'll always have someone in the crowd that isn't completely
happy with you. Those two things alone can make your gig a very
stressful situation, especially when that person in the crowd let's you
know how they feel! Sometimes I wish I had an invisible sheild around
the booth to keep out the meanies.
6.) Maybe cliche, but my
mother has influenced me the most. Her love for music and drive to help
others has made a huge impact on who I am today. She is an amazing
person and I hope that I can become half the woman she is!
7.) If I could play anywhere in the world, it would definitely be in Italy. I would love to make my roots dance 4 me!!
8.) DON'T give up. As frustrating as it will all be in the beginning,
it is all worth it. Mixing will get easier, and the joy of looking up
and seeing people smiling and dancing to your beats is simply priceless.
9.) I create my sounds through the passion of movement and happiness.
The creation of other people's sounds that I play for others is chosen
carefully to make sure my taste is projected to those listening ears!!
Bet you weren't expecting that answer!
10.) It is essential for
me to have an extended supply of music with a variety of genres
available in case I'm needed longer or if it looks like I should change
the style up a bit. It's also essential to go into a gig with a good
attitude and energy.
DJing is very powerful and is something I
am very passionate about. Making people move to my selection of music,
along with my own productions now is an amazing feeling. Running events
that accomplish those things ALONG with helping others at the same time,
is a feeling that I can't explain. I hope others use their powers to do
what I've been doing for a couple years now; bring people together to
share a dance floor while helping others. Even if you ask your attendees
to each bring a can of soup to the event, it's a small donation but you
are putting food in someone's belly that probably needs it more than
you. I know others do events like this, so I hope they continue that
path and I hope others catch on too!
